    I have a desktop running Win XP.
    Had powercut twice and following that, I get the normal options to start in SAFE MODE, NORMALLY etc.
    Problem is, now keyboard does not respond so I can't chose any option
    - which just makes Windows restart after 30secs.
    And that just repeats until I kill the computer.

    I've tried using different USB port and another keyboard, without luck.

    Any good suggestions?

    If you have a PS2 port on your MB and a PS2 keyboard you could try that.
